NJ man arrested after hiding camera inside barbershop bathroom, police claim

A New Jersey man has been arrested and charged after, police claim, he hid a camera inside a bathroom at a barbershop in Mantua Township.

According to police, on Feb. 13, 2026, the owner of Gino’s Barbershop contacted officials after he discovered a “spy camera” hidden inside a restroom at the shop.

An investigation led police to apprehend Richard Doerrmann, 55, from Mickleton, New Jersey, officials said.

Doerrmann, was employed as a barber at the establishment, and police claim he is alleged to have placed spy cameras in bathrooms at the barbershop “on multiple occasions.”

Following his arrest, Doerrmann has been charged with invasion of privacy and related offenses, officials said.

An investigation into this incident is ongoing and, officials are asking anyone who may have information in this case to contact Detective Corporal Jeffrey Krieger at jkrieger@mantuatownship.com.
